I am trying to do a 'zfs send -i' and failing. This is my simple proof of concept test: Create the data # zfs create storage/a # touch /storage/a/1 # touch /storage/a/2 # touch /storage/a/3 Snapshot # zfs snapshot storage/a@2010.10.19 send # zfs send storage/a@2010.10.19 | zfs receive -v storage/compressed/a receiving full stream of storage/a@2010.10.19 into storage/compressed/a@2010.10.19 received 252KB stream in 2 seconds (126KB/sec) # Create one more file and snapshot that # touch /storage/a/4 # zfs snapshot storage/a@2010.10.20 send it # zfs send -i storage/a@2010.10.19 storage/a@2010.10.20 | zfs receive -v storage/compressed/a receiving incremental stream of storage/a@2010.10.20 into storage/compressed/a@2010.10.20 received 250KB stream in 3 seconds (83.4KB/sec) What do we have? # find /storage/compressed/a /storage/compressed/a /storage/compressed/a/1 /storage/compressed/a/2 /storage/compressed/a/3 /storage/compressed/a/4 Of note: * FreeBSD 8.1-STABLE * ZFS filesystem version 4. * ZFS pool version 15. * zfs send is on compression off * zfs receive has compression on What I actually want to do and what fails: # zfs snapshot storage/bacula@2010.10.19 # zfs send storage/bacula@2010.10.19 | zfs receive -v storage/compressed/bacula receiving full stream of storage/bacula@2010.10.19 into storage/compressed/bacula@2010.10.19 received 4.38TB stream in 42490 seconds (108MB/sec) # zfs snapshot storage/bacula@2010.10.20 # zfs send -i storage/bacula@2010.10.19 storage/bacula@2010.10.20 | zfs receive -v storage/compressed/bacula receiving incremental stream of storage/bacula@2010.10.20 into storage/compressed/bacula@2010.10.20 cannot receive incremental stream: destination storage/compressed/bacula has been modified since most recent snapshot warning: cannot send 'storage/bacula@2010.10.20': Broken pipe I have no idea why this fails. Clues please? To my knowledge, the destination has not been written to. -- Dan Langille -- http://langille.org/
